Output 10021ecfbf3468ce4df95ffd5871a4a028228dfddcbae6b03cb5d18feb78f62b:1

value
684103
script pubkey
OP_0 OP_PUSHBYTES_20 ee4d12b01a198e0dfcb71cd8c061509f79ce14fb
address
bc1qaex39vq6rx8qml9hrnvvqc2snauuu98m2rwhkv
transaction
10021ecfbf3468ce4df95ffd5871a4a028228dfddcbae6b03cb5d18feb78f62b
spent
true